- Corporate culture and guiding principles:
We are professional intermediaries playing a pivotal role in the world's financial markets, covering FX, Rates, Credit, Equities, Energy & Commodities.
Globally, we are a leading provider of market participants, with execution via a range of regulated venues, covering a full spectrum of over-the-counter (OTC) asset classes.
Matching buyers and sellers, we facilitate the development of liquidity and price discovery in these markets and provide insight and context to our clients.
We operate a hybrid model where brokers provide business-critical intelligence to clients. It's supplemented by proprietary screens for historical data, analytics and execution functionality.
Our clients include banks, insurance companies, pension and hedge funds, asset managers, energy producers and refiners, as well as risk and compliance managers and charities.
We are known in the market for our Honesty, Integrity and Excellence in the provision of service to our clients.
Job duties:
- Proactively partner the business management in the delivery of their strategic business plans by developing, advising and aligning people strategies and plans to organisational goals and helping to create and maintain a high performing workforce centred on TP ICAP values.
- Conceptualise, facilitate and advise business leaders in rolling out Business-HR Projects designed to optimise business outcomes through targeted HR interventions
- Develop a strong understanding of businesses/customers and provide timely, insightful and comprehensive HR advice/solutions to pertinent inter/intrabusiness and regional issues
- Partner Business Units in the implementation and governance of HR policies, practices and initiatives across APAC
- Manage crossborders as well as complex employee issues including but not limited to restructuring, redundancies, executive contract/performance management, managerial/employee coaching, compromise agreements, disciplinary and grievance cases.
- Develop, review and support rolling out of regional HR policy and processes across APAC
- Support the Group's people data and analytics requirements in a timely and accurate manner
- Actively spearhead and participate in global and regional initiatives and projects
- Shape the organisational culture in APAC region through conceptualisation and execution of targeted HR initiatives and programmes designed to drive a high performing organisation anchored on TP ICAP values.
- Provide any HR operational support as and when required
